Finchampstead Fire Blues delivered one of their finest performances of the season, combining grit, flair, and sheer determination to secure a brilliant 3–1 win over Bracknell Wolves. It was a match full of character, quality, and togetherness, everythin

The opener was impressive. Tallulah seized on a loose ball after Lalia's pressing, firing a first-time shot from 25 yards, a highlight reel goal and a strong start for the Blues.

Ava doubled the lead with a sensational solo effort. She refused to give up on a seemingly lost cause, battled through challenges and showed exactly what happens when you keep persevering. A brilliant finish and a brilliant example to the whole squad.

With the final seconds ticking away and legs tiring, Tallulah somehow found another gear. She burst past two defenders, outpaced the goalkeeper and slotted home with composure. Determination, speed, and heart all in one moment.

The back line had to deal with more than just football. Some foul play and physical challenges came their way but they stood tall, battled hard, and refused to be rattled.
Faith was outstanding between the posts, making several important saves that kept Finchampstead in control. The team deserved a clean sheet and were desperately unlucky not to keep one.

The midfield and wingbacks had a great game and never let Bracknell settle into the game. A special mention goes to Eva Rose who slotted into the attacking midfield role when needed and delivered an intelligent performance linking play, pressing hard and supporting both ends of the pitch.

From first whistle to last, this was one of our best displays of the past few season. Every player contributed. Every player fought. Every player lifted the team.

The league and cup double remains firmly in our own hands. Seven huge league matches to go, a massive cup semi final ahead, and hopefully another final on the horizon!
